Crafting the Costume

Dress:

  • Use a standard blue fabric: Choose a lightweight cotton or linen blend for breathability and comfort.
  • Create the flared skirt: Sew rectangular panels together at angles to achieve the A-line silhouette.
  • Add a white apron: Cut and stitch a square or rectangle of white fabric onto the front of the skirt.
  • Embellish with lace or ruffles: Add delicate lace or fluted ruffles to the hem of the apron or neckline for a feminine touch.

Blouse:

  • Select a white blouse: Opt for a Victorian-inspired blouse with puffy sleeves or a ruffled neckline.
  • Create a ruffled collar: Sew a strip of fabric around the neck opening, gathering it at regular intervals.
  • Embellish with embroidery or ribbons: Embroider intricate designs or add ribbons to the collar or sleeves for a touch of whimsy.

Makeup and Hair

Makeup:

  • Natural base: Start with a light foundation or BB cream to create a flawless canvas.
  • Soft pink cheeks: Apply a subtle blush to the apples of your cheeks for a youthful flush.
  • Hazelnut eyes: Use neutral eyeshadows in shades of brown and hazelnut to define your eyes.
  • False lashes: Add a touch of drama with subtle false lashes to enhance your gaze.
  • Red lips: Finish with a classic red lipstick for a pop of color.

Hair:

  • Blonde curls: If your hair is not naturally blonde, consider using a temporary hair dye or wig.
  • Side-swept braids: Braid one side of your hair and sweep it across your head, pinning it into place.
  • Loose waves: Create soft, flowing waves using a curling iron or wand.
  • Hair accessories: Add a headband or fascinator to complete your look.
